Gunfire wounds four, kills one in Philadelphia

wpvi
By 6abc
PHILADELPHIA - Augist 16, 2008

The violence claimed the life of a man in Nicetown-Tioga. He was shot several times.

Another man was shot four times in Juniata. He was rushed to a hospital in very bad shape.

Gunfire also wounded a man and woman in Hunting Park, and wounded a man in Port Richmond.

Police have not announced any arrests in these cases.

Shootings last weekend left four people dead and five others in hospitals.
